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- invisalign dentist london

Sort by
  • Bayswater Dental Clinic
    02072294627
    1 Cervantes Court, Inverness Terrace, Bayswater, London
    At Bayswater Dental Clinic, our dentists provide quality dental care and services to meet the expectations of patients. We welcome anxi..... Treatment

    Listed In : doctors Dental Doctors

    View Details